Capturing lead information from visitors is critical in getting the most out of your website. Instead of having someone find your website, visit it once, and then forget about it, obtaining lead information allows you to stay connected with prospective customers. This tutorial is going to look at how you can create a lead capture form specifically for Joomla websites.
You can use the information you capture to contact prospective customers over the phone, by email, social media, direct mail or any other direct marketing method you choose. Decide how you want to approach your website visitors and then include the necessary information in a lead capture form.
Step 1: Create A Plan
Before we do anything we’ll need to create a plan and determine the information we want to collect. We’ll need enough data to work with, but don’t want to demand too much in case we turn potential customers away.
We’ll also need to consider where we want to put the lead capture form and what we’ll offer to entice people to enter their contact information.
To encourage people to volunteer their information you’ll often have to offer some value in return. This could be anything like a free report, white paper, or access a special newsletter. There are many ways to offer something that people will be interested in providing their contact information for. Be creative. Step 3: (Optional) AC File Payments
AC File Payments is another great plugin for Joomla. It enables visitors to download files from your site. If you want to provide a download for visitors after they fill out your lead capture form you will need this or an equivalent Joomla extension.
